1979-2009: a decline in participation
– 1979: The 9 (Germany, Belgium, France, Italy, Luxembourg, Netherlands, Denmark, Ireland, UK)
– 1984: The 10 (The 9 + Greece)
– 1998 et 1994: The 12 (The 10 + Spain, Portugal)
– 1999: The 15 (The 12 + Austria, Finland, Sweden)
– 2004: The 25 (The 15 + Cyprus, Estonia, Hungary, Latvia, Lithuania, Malta, Poland, Slovakia, Slovenia et Czech Republic).
– 2009 : EU27 – The 25 Member States + Bulgaria and Romania in 2007.
– 2014: UE28 (The 27 Member States + Croatia)

1979 – 2009 : The growth of the electoral body
Nearly 185 million European voters were called to ballot in 1979 in comparison with nearly 375 million in 2009.
